Transaction 763a1dd50f23784d843028f8e3dfbfdb97c60db5314d369209cb3ff681f9e45a
1 Input
1 Output
-
763a1dd50f23784d843028f8e3dfbfdb97c60db5314d369209cb3ff681f9e45a:0
- value
- 2464872
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2ef3663f9da67cc583f4527d238327044b05d0b
- address
- bc1qcthnvclemfnuckplg5naywpjwpztqhgtzsvgea